Transaction 2ce26f00bc24b7606cb493c85a9c85377b00623f591c6679d20bf1012dcf4e7f
4 Input
2 Outputs
- 2ce26f00bc24b7606cb493c85a9c85377b00623f591c6679d20bf1012dcf4e7f:0
- 2ce26f00bc24b7606cb493c85a9c85377b00623f591c6679d20bf1012dcf4e7f:1
value 1348910
address 12WHWc4sSXDvKivEzy9ycYCiGsXgXDmoQg
value 23979690
address 19cP14k2AkUCYsDqjqUEin89nM544cjRRv